Great Britain 3:2 Australia
The matches were played in Glasgow, Great Britain, from 18 September to 20 September 2015.
- In the 1st Rubber, Andy Murray comfortably defeated Australia's Thanasi Kokkinakis in straight sets 6-3 6-0 6-3.
- Rubber 2, Bernard Tomic won against Great Britain's Daniel Evans in 4 sets, 6-3 7-6(2) 6-7(4) 6-4.
- Rubber 3 was the doubles, which was 5 tight sets, however, Great Britain's Jamie Murray and Andy Murray won against Sam Groth and Lleyton Hewitt.
- In Rubber 4, Andy Murray defeated Bernard Tomic in straight sets, 7-5 6-3 6-2. This meant that Great Britain had won the tie, and made it to the final of the Davis Cup.
- However, the 5th Rubber was still played, which was a dead rubber, with Australia's Thanasi Kokkinakis defeating Daniel Evans.

Belgium 3:2 Argentina
Played in Brussels, Belgium, from 18 September to 20 September 2015.
- Rubber 1: Steve Darcis (Belgium) defeated Federico Delbonis (Argentina), 6-4 2-6 7-5 7-6(3)
- Rubber 2: David Goffin (Belgium) wins 7-5 7-6(3) 6-3.
- Rubber 3 (doubles): Argentina defeat Belgium, 6-2 7-6(2) 5-7 7-6(5).
- Rubber 4: Leonardo Mayer (Argentina) defeated Steve Darcis, 7-6(5) 7-6(1) 4-6 6-3• Rubber 5: David Goffin beat Diego Schwartzman, 6-3 6-2 6-1. Belgium in the tie and make it to the Davis Cup Final.
